Anyways, while we were in the lunch, the church had a tradition.

These recruits are all of the LDS members who finished boot camp.
The generals there introduce themselves along with their rank and how long they have served in the Marines. Afterwards, they then would give a small history lesson about the church in the service of the Marines. 
This is Cale introducing himself to everyone at the lunch.

The general was cutting the cake with a marine sword...I thought that was pretty cool.









Than the general asked the recruits to state their names, ranks, where they were from and where they will be going.



















After the introduction, they ended the tradition with the cutting of the cake with a Marine's sword. Overall, it was very touching to see and learn what the church does with services.
